Web服务器开发(一)基于阿里云ECS服务器WEB服务器环境的搭建

article/2025/10/22 10:27:32
本章主要讲解如何购买和配置阿里云ECS服务器以及搭建网络站点。

一 阿里云ECS服务器

(一)购买阿里云服务器(只要实名认证24岁下,可以直接购买学生机)

1 注册阿里云,这步就不细说了。
2 配置ECS服务器
(1):在这里插入图片描述
(2):
在这里插入图片描述
(3)选择收费方式,配置CPU
在这里插入图片描述
(4)选择开发系统以及存储盘
在这里插入图片描述
(5) 配置网络带宽,安全组端口,然后下一步
在这里插入图片描述
(6) 为系统用户配置密码,记录下用户名和密码,然后下一步
在这里插入图片描述
(7) 下一步下单,然后购买。购买后
在这里插入图片描述
在这里插入图片描述在这里插入图片描述
(8)记录下ip地址,到这里服务器购买结束。

(二)连接阿里云服务器

1 win+r,打开运行,出入mstsc
在这里插入图片描述
2 输入刚才记录下的公网ip地址
在这里插入图片描述
3 实现本地资源与服务器的共享
在这里插入图片描述
4 连接
在这里插入图片描述
5 输入记录下来的用户密码
在这里插入图片描述
6 连接成功在这里插入图片描述
在这里插入图片描述

(三)阿里云服务器配置http服务器

1.安装WEB服务器
(1)打开服务器管理器,选择添加角色和功能在这里插入图片描述
(2) 一直下一步直到选择web服务器,其他默认,应用程序开发全选,以防开发以后需要。
在这里插入图片描述
(3)添加功能
在这里插入图片描述
(4)安装,等待一会。
2.配置IIS
(1)打开IIS
在这里插入图片描述
(2)可以看到已经有默认的站点
在这里插入图片描述
(3)新建文件夹,新建htm文件
在这里插入图片描述
(4)右键网站,添加网站,名称随意,应用池选择默认,路径选择刚才新建的文件夹,ip地址这里输入记录下的私网ip地址,端口写8080
在这里插入图片描述
这时候虽然建好了站,但是由于阿里云服务器的安全组没有开放8080端口,随意还无法访问。

(四)阿里云服务器配置安全组规则

1.在这里插入图片描述
2.添加安全组规则
在这里插入图片描述
好了,现在可以在本地计算机访问刚刚建立的网站,注意这里使用公网ip地址。

在这里插入图片描述
下章将介绍如何配置安全域名,备案域名时间有些长。


http://chatgpt.dhexx.cn/article/EMDkDZwO.shtml

相关文章

在Eclipse中配置Web服务器,并开发部署一个简单的web应用

1、单击Eclipse下方面板的“Server”面板,在该面板的空白处单击鼠标右键,在弹出的快捷菜单中选择“New→Server”菜单项 2、弹出如下对话框,选择“Apache→Tomcat v7.0 Server”节点 3、Next,出现如下对话框,填写Tomca…

如何搭建web服务器

现在很多网页的编写的时候都要求做成响应式的,而相应的就需要我们实时的进行调试。而如何更方便的利用各种设备查看我们更新的页面内容呢?接下来,我们就来学习一下关于web服务器的搭建(这样只要在同一个局域网内,只要输…

web服务器的开发(简易版本)

文章目录 总体介绍使用的知识总结:http协议请求报文格式:http协议响应消息格式:使用epoll模型作为web服务器: 总体介绍 使用浏览器作为客户端访问web服务器; 使用的知识总结: socktet编程: socket -> setsock…

C++ web server服务器 开发

本文是牛客网Linux 高并发服务器开发视频教程的笔记 1、预备知识 1.1 Linux与远程 使用ssh在widows中控制Linux系统,使用vscode控制代码 使用g编译 1.1 静态库与动态库 静态库与动态库的制作、区别 1.2 makefile makefile文件操作就是指定所有源文件的编译顺序…

Web 服务器的搭建

1.下载Nginx源码: wget http://nginx.org/download/nginx-1.19.4.tar.gz2.解压Nginx源码: tar -zxvf nginx-1.19.4.tar.gz 3.安装相关依赖 sudo apt-get install openssl libssl-dev libpcre3 libpcre3-dev zlib1g-dev –y4. 进入到nginx-1.19.4目录…

Tomcat服务器和Web开发介绍

Tomcat服务器和Web开发介绍 一、开启Web开发 什么是web开发 WEB,即网页的意思,它用于表示Internet主机上供外界访问的资源。 Internet上供外界访问的Web资源分为: 静态web资源(如html 页面):指web页面中供…

C#开发自己的Web服务器

下载源代码 介绍 我们将学习如何写一个简单的web服务器,用于响应知名的HTTP请求(GET和POST),用C#发送响应。然后,我们从网络访问这台服务器,这次我们会说“Hello world!” 背景 HTTP协议 HTTP是服务器和客户机之间的通…

Web开发介绍

Web开发介绍 1 什么是web开发 Web:全球广域网,也称为万维网(www World Wide Web),能够通过浏览器访问的网站。 所以Web开发说白了,就是开发网站的,例如下图所示的网站:淘宝,京东等等 那么我们…

搭建web服务器

1.要求搭建web服务器,能够访问到网页内容为“小胖,你咋这么胖呢!” 2.要求搭建web服务器,创建基于域名的虚拟主机,能够使用www.xiaopang.com和www.dapang.com访问各自的网站网站存放路径分别为/xiaopang和/dapang,内容…

Web开发及服务器

转载自https://www.cnblogs.com/xdp-gacl/p/3729033.html。 一、基本概念 1.1、WEB开发的相关知识 WEB,在英语中web即表示网页的意思,它用于表示Internet主机上供外界访问的资源。 Internet上供外界访问的Web资源分为: 静态web资源&#x…

EI数据库免费检索入口

转载自:http://www.ei-istp.com/New_691.html 具体查询方式,详看链接。

数据库搜索与索引

索引是对数据库表中一列或多列的值进行排序的一种结构,使用索引可快速访问数据库表中的特定信息。如果想按特定职员的姓来查找他或她,则与在表中搜索所有的行相比,索引有助于更快地获取信息。 索引的一个主要目的就是加快检索表中数据&#x…

数据库 索引

多数数据库,使用 B 树(Balance Tree)的结构来保存索引。 B 树, 最上层节点:根节点 最下层节点:叶子节点 两者之间的节点:中间节点 B 树,显著特征:从根节点,到…

mysql全库搜索关键字_数据库 全文检索

一、概述 MySQL全文检索是利用查询关键字和查询列内容之间的相关度进行检索,可以利用全文索引来提高匹配的速度。 二、语法 MATCH (col1,col2,...) AGAINST (expr [search_modifier]) search_modifier: { IN BOOLEAN MODE | WITH QUERY EXPANSION } 例如:SELECT * FROM tab_n…

人文社科类文献去哪些数据库检索下载

查找下载人文社科类文献的数据库大盘点: 1、文献党下载器(wxdown.org) 大型文献馆,几乎整合汇集了所有中外文献数据库资源,可附带权限进入文献数据库查找下载文献,覆盖全科包括查找下载人文社科类文献的众…

数据库索引的实现原理

强烈建议参阅链接:http://www.linezing.com/blog/?p=798#nav-1 说白了,索引问题就是一个查找问题。。。 数据库索引,是数据库管理系统中一个排序的数据结构,以协助快速查询、更新数据库表中数据。索引的实现通常使用B树及其变种B+树。 在数据之外,数据库系统还维护着满足…

WoS数据库使用及检索示例

目录 快速了解一个领域的情况 1. 核心合集检索和所有数据库检索的区别 2. 检索结果分析 2.1 排序方式(日期,被引频次) 2.2 分析检索结果 2.3 精炼检索结果(二次检索) 2.4 创建引文报告 2.5 具体某一篇文献 快…

【MySQL】检索数据

每日鸡汤 : —— 若你困于无风之地,我将奏响高空之歌 要和我一起花 10 min 学一会 SQL 嘛? - 当然愿意,我美丽的小姐 (封寝期间练就的自言自语能力越来越炉火纯青了~~~) 前言: 本实验中所用数据…

数据库的检索(select)

今天我们学习一下数据库检索语句,由于经常用到,有需求的小伙伴欢迎来查看哦! 一、简单的查询 --获取所以列 select * from T_table --获取部分列 select id, title from T_table 效果展示: 在...之间:Between.. a…

《MySQL必知必会》学习笔记之“数据库的检索”

文章目录 第一章 SQL与MySQL1 数据库基础2 什么是SQL3 客户机—服务器软件4 MySQL工具mysql命令行实用程序(使用最多的实用程序之一)MySQL AdministratorMySQL Query Browser 第二章 使用MySQL1 连接2选择数据库3了解数据库和表4 注释 第三章 检索数据1 …